Dr. On Shun Pak serves as an Associate Professor in the Department of Mechanical Engineering at Santa Clara University's School of Engineering with a courtesy appointment in Applied Mathematics, and is an external faculty member at NJIT's Center of Applied Mathematics and Statistics.
Education:
- B.Eng. in Mechanical Engineering, University of Hong Kong (2008)
- Ph.D. in Mechanical Engineering, University of California, San Diego (2013)
- Post-doctoral Research Fellow, Princeton University
Research Focus: Dr. Pak employs advanced mathematical tools to investigate fundamental fluid mechanics phenomena and interdisciplinary applications. His work bridges theoretical modeling with practical implementations across biological and microscale systems.
Key Contributions: Research spans microswimmer locomotion, biological flow dynamics, complex fluid behavior, and low-Reynolds-number hydrodynamics, revealing critical insights into fluid-structure interactions at microscopic scales.
Awards:
- University Award for Recent Achievement in Scholarship, Santa Clara University (2021)
- Research Excellence Award, School of Engineering (2017)
- Teaching Excellence Award, School of Engineering (2015)
- Siebel Scholar, Siebel Foundation (2013)
- Croucher Foundation Scholarship and Fellowship (2010, 2013)
Academic Leadership: Teaches core engineering mathematics, thermodynamics, and fluid mechanics courses while mentoring graduate researchers. Leads an active fluid dynamics research group focusing on theoretical and computational approaches to microscale flow problems.
